HIGH SCHOOL DROPOUTS
Study of high school dropouts from loeal and national standpoint. Why youths leave school, what problems do they face, how is their leisure time spent? Not available for sponsorship. 30 minutes (4-24-63).
GO BACK TO SCHOOL
Sequel to High School Dropouts. Programed to encourage youths to return to school. Not available for sponsorship. 30 minutes (8-14-63).

Amateur boxing in cooperation with Louisville Parks and Recreation Department to promote youth fitness and wholesome supervised activity. Not available for spwjnsorship. 30 minutes (Weekly).
Outdoor activities, principally hunting and fishing, with Kentucky Fish and Wild Life Resources Dept., to promote fishing and hunting facilities and conserx'ative practices. Not available for spon.sorship. 30 minutes (Weekly).
Four high school students discuss current issues with moderator. Not a\ailable for sponsorship. 30 minutes (Weekly).
Live remote telecast from station farm, covering all aspects of agriculture. Sponsor: International Mineral & Chemical. 30 minutes (5-11; 5-25; 6-15; 6-22-63).
